An idea to change how turns work to make 40k games more realistic and more active:

>each unit gets for actions that it can spread out any way it wants between movement, psychic, shooting, and assault
>at the start of the turn, player 1 picks a unit and takes one action
>player 2 picks a unit and takes one action
>so on and so forth until all units on the board have been moved, at which point the turn ends
>psychic phase only generates warp charges once per turn
>the player with more mastery levels rolls the D6
>independent characters must spend an action point to leave a unit and can then use their next action point to do whatever they want


What other sort of rules interactions would need to be cleared up?

After looking at the list of basically all grots oast thread, I was inspired to fine tune it a bit, to make it even better, so behold THE GROT TIDE:

Combined Arms Detachment 1:

HQ (200 points):
Big Mek (115pts) Cybork Body, Mega Force Field
Big Mek (85pts) Kustom Force Field

Troops (345 points):
3 units of Gretchin (115pts): 30x Gretchin, 3x Runtherd

Combined Arms Detachment 2:

HQ (190 points):
2x Big Mek (85pts) Kustom Force Field

Troops (230 points):
2 units of Gretchin (115pts): 30x Gretchin, 3x Runtherd

Lord of War (735 points):
Kustom Stompa (735pts) Big Shoota 2x Bursta Kannon, Deth Arsenal, Gaze of Mork, Power Field

Unbound Army (190 points):
2x Big Mek (85pts) Kustom Force Field

1850 points total

The strategy is simple: 150 grots. Use the 5 regular big meks with kustom force field to provide them with a 5++, making them a bit more resilient. Put the big mek with the mega force field in the stompa to give the stompa a 4+ invul save.
Use the Kustom stompa to take out anything big, grots overwhelm the enemy.

Now, I'll admit I'm not an ork player, so I'm not sure if that's the best load out for the stompa, but 2 D guns, one gun that has a 2/11 chance to be D, 3D6 S9 ap3 shots as well as d3 s8 AP3 5“ blast each turn seems pretty good to me.

Asked this in another thread but didnt get an answer. Can an eradication beamer fire snap shots? Within 9' It doesnt have the blast rule.

>Can an eradication beamer fire snap shots?
only if its firing at something within 9 inches

Yeah, within 9" it's heavy 1 so it can snap shoot, but in the case of overwatch, only if the charge began within 9"

I play DA and like a unit of 10 with bolters outflanking. Most of them usually survive the game and put out a fair bit of dakka that can't really be focused down without taking firepower away from my scary units like DW&Black knights. Great for mid table objective grabbing.

With BA getting furious charge and +1 initiative right there I'd suggest a similar tactic, but with pistols & maybe a couple of shotguns to a unit, you're sending up a fairly cheap unit assault unit that either takes the heat off death company or other meatier assault units and forces the opposing player to make decisions.
